The Revolutionary Approach Of Process Pharma

In the world of pharmaceuticals, innovation is key. Companies are constantly striving to find new ways to develop drugs more efficiently and effectively. One approach that has been gaining attention in recent years is process pharma.

process pharma is a revolutionary approach to drug development that focuses on optimizing the entire process of pharmaceutical production. This includes everything from the initial research and development of a drug to its manufacture and distribution. By taking a holistic view of the process, companies are able to identify areas of inefficiency and develop strategies to improve them.

One of the key principles of process pharma is the idea of continuous improvement. This involves constantly monitoring and analyzing every step of the drug development process to identify opportunities for optimization. By making small, incremental changes over time, companies can achieve significant improvements in efficiency and quality.

process pharma also places a strong emphasis on collaboration and communication. In traditional drug development approaches, different departments within a company often work in isolation from each other. This can lead to miscommunication, duplication of efforts, and delays in the development process. In contrast, process pharma encourages a more integrated approach, with teams working closely together to share information and ideas.

By breaking down silos and fostering collaboration, companies can streamline the drug development process and achieve better outcomes. This integrated approach also allows companies to respond more quickly to changes in the market or regulatory environment, ensuring that they stay ahead of the competition.

Another key aspect of process pharma is the use of data and technology to drive decision-making. Companies are increasingly relying on advanced analytics and artificial intelligence to analyze complex datasets and identify patterns that can inform drug development strategies. By harnessing the power of data, companies can make more informed decisions and achieve better outcomes.

For example, companies can use predictive modeling to identify the most promising drug candidates early in the development process, saving time and resources. They can also use real-time data analytics to monitor the progress of clinical trials and quickly identify any issues that may arise. By leveraging technology in this way, companies can make their drug development processes more efficient and effective.

One of the hallmarks of process pharma is its focus on quality and compliance. In an industry where patient safety is paramount, companies must adhere to strict regulations and quality standards throughout the drug development process. process pharma emphasizes the importance of quality control at every stage, from research and development to manufacturing and distribution.

By implementing robust quality management systems and adhering to best practices, companies can ensure that their drugs meet the highest standards of safety and efficacy. This not only protects patients but also helps companies build a strong reputation in the industry.
